As an SVP Engineering Manager within FX Technology Tier 1 Investment Bank, you will provide senior technical and people leadership across critical FX and Cross‑Border Payments platforms. You will operate as a trusted technology partner to the business, accountable for delivery, architectural direction, and engineering excellence. This is a hands‑on leadership role, combining strategic oversight with deep technical engagement. The role does not carry direct budget responsibility but has significant influence across platform strategy and delivery.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ead, mentor, and inspire high‑performing engineering teams delivering mission‑critical FX systems
- Partner with senior stakeholders across FX Technology and Payments to define and implement scalable, business‑aligned solutions
- Drive platform and system architecture using an AI‑first and cloud‑aware approach utilising a throughput Java platform with performance, latency performance and resilience central to your approach.
- Provide technical thought leadership, remaining close to code, design decisions, and delivery quality
- Shape team structure, roles, and responsibilities to maximise impact, efficiency, and resilience
- Own senior people‑management responsibilities including hiring, performance management, development, and succession planning
- Ensure strong adherence to engineering standards, risk controls, and documented policies and procedures
- Champion best practices, transparency, and consistency across the wider technology organisation
- Lead local and regional staff forums, communicating global strategy and progress to teams
- Act as an engineering role model and senior influencer across Technology and the wider organisation
Key Skills & Experience Required:
- Proven experience working closely with FX or Cross‑Border Payments business teams
- Strong understanding of FX market structure, workflows, and technology platforms
- Demonstrable track record of building new Java systems, modernising legacy platforms, and leading large‑scale change
- Deep understanding of complex system architectures spanning software, infrastructure, and networks
- Proven ability to build and lead high‑performing engineering teams at scale
- Exceptional communication skills, with the credibility to influence senior technology and business stakeholders
- Strong experience collaborating across globally distributed and cross‑functional teams
- Computer Science or Maths‑related degree
Preferred:
- Broad engineering background with hands‑on credibility and the ability to deep‑dive into Java codebases
- Experience leveraging emerging technologies and industry trends to drive platform evolution
- Background operating at SVP / senior engineering leadership level within a complex, regulated environment
